DL8000 Preset Instruction Manual
Revised February-2016 Communications Protocols D-59
Set Program
Code Values
[0x23]
Results
Some parameters are set after scaling. The scale
can be a fixed multiplication factor or may depend
on some other configurable parameter.
The scaled parameters are :
457/459/461/463 Backup density – scaling
multiplication factor = 1 / (10 ^ (PC046
Density/Gravity Scale )
Deviations
Transaction authorized exception is checked in
place of Transaction in progress
Configure Recipe
[0x27]
Use this command when configuring specific recipes.
Inline blending has special considerations. Set the low/high proportion flags
carefully; it is possible that a particular component is high proportion (flag=0)
for some recipes and low proportion (flag=1) for different recipes on the same
DL8000. This is a function of the size of meter (and thus the usable range of
flow rates) through which the component flows. You may need to modify the
overall recipe low and high flow rates [68,x,23 and 24] if you modify
component percentages through communications.
This command does not automatically increase or decrease the configured
number of recipes [63,0,26].
Program Code Value Changed
Flags Immediately
Cleared
None
Exceptions
Primary alarm active
Transaction authorized
Operating mode is manual
Invalid recipe number
Invalid Number of components (if number of
components received in command request
frame is not the same as the configured
number of components)
Invalid Program Code Value (if component
percentage received is more than 100 or any
character received in delivery sequence is
non-numeric or is more than ASCII equivalent
of configured number of components)
Supporting
Parameters
Recipe name [68,x,0]
Percentage of component 1 [68,x,1]
Percentage of component 2 [68,x,2]
Percentage of component 3 [68,x,3]
Percentage of component 4 [68,x,4]
Component Delivery Sequence or low/high
proportion [68,x,17]
Number of components [63,0,21]
Results
If no exceptions are raised then parameters
received for the recipe get written to the above
locations.
Deviations
Supports additional exception such as Invalid
program code value